Output 8ddd26f64289bb8648c79ccacb2a745c9c7990715857337bfab24941c3d274d5:6

value
8354688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 295c5ba3601d874916b84be0abe8fa54a4bbf6f0 OP_EQUALVERIFY OP_CHECKSIG
address
14mhM1WM4qsqyvegCN8ALj9tzmVTwbumTy
transaction
8ddd26f64289bb8648c79ccacb2a745c9c7990715857337bfab24941c3d274d5
spent
true